Finally finished! It fought me until the very end. Last problem was that a chunk of wood I had glued against the center block was just wide enough to keep the jack from fitting. Fortunately this was fixable by using a thin chisel through to hole.

It sounds great! The pickup in the mudbucker position is nice and dark, but not muddy. The one in the middle position is very p-bass like. It has four distinct humbucking settings--the fourth is when both single coils are engaged.

Single coil sounds are good, but there's a little buzz. But in any humbucking setting it's dead quiet. I used shielded cable in the wiring harness and that may have helped.
